New Woodland Grants: Countryside Stewardship Rides Again!

Defra published the first details about the new grant scheme for woodlands last week.  This will now be known as Countryside Stewardship, having been referred to referred to as New Environmental Stewardship Scheme (or NELMS) in earlier consultations.  It seeks to combine the previous Environmental Stewardship and Woodland Grant Schemes.  A bit more information was

Continue Reading →